In a segment of the game that appears after the credits, titled Bad Boy Love, the world of dating pigeons is suddenly revealed to be a dystopia in which humanity and birdmanity have been at war with each other, each trying to infect the other with infectious diseases. After the credits, Hatoful Boyfriend takes a much darker turn, also in line with some otome games. So she decided to really give people a game about pigeons, one with a fully-fleshed out world and dark secrets to uncover. Less of a personal gag, Mao had learned that people really responded to her game about dating pigeons. With a hit on her hands, she decided to develop the game further.Ī few months later, a newer iteration of the game came out. The site hosting the game crashed as word of a pigeon dating sim made its way through social media. She goes on to describe the game as “originally a silly joke” which very quickly became a big hit. In addition, I like to write scripts more than draw, so it was much easier for me to use pictures of pigeons rather than draw people,” she said in an interview with the Russian website Look at Me. I decided to make a visual novel about birds, because since childhood I adored them, especially pigeons. ![]() ![]() ![]() ![]() I wanted to learn how to create visual novels, and I thought I should start with something short, simple. “The idea of Hatoful Boyfriend came to me in 2011, the day before April 1.
